Detailed vulnerability description
The vulnerability allows a local user to cause a denial of service.
The vulnerability exists due to a race condition in aql_enable_write in the mac80211 debugfs interface when handling concurrent write operations to debugfs. A local user can perform concurrent writes to the aql control file to cause a denial of service.
